Flora MacDonald
Hebridean woman who helped Bonnie Prince Charlie escape after the 1746 defeat at Culloden, becoming an enduring symbol of the Scottish Highlands.
- Lived: 1722 CE – 1790 CE
- Nationality: British
- Roles: Jacobite figure
